The 32 mm system

Most commercial cabinet hardware is built around the 32 mm system — shelf pin holes spaced 32 mm (1.26″) apart in a continuous vertical line, with a 37 mm setback from the front edge. Nearly every European hinge, drawer slide and shelf support is dimensioned to that grid.

32 mm or 1 inch? If you are using commercial hardware, jigs or line boring, use 32 mm. If you are building one-off shop cabinets with a shop-made jig, a 1″ or 1-1/4″ spacing is perfectly serviceable and easier to lay out in imperial. What matters far more is that all four columns match.

Hole diameter and depth

Pin typeHole diameterDepth
Standard shelf pin5 mm (or 3/16″)1/2″
Larger shelf pin1/4″1/2″
Spoon-style support5 mm1/2″
Shelf pin with sleeve1/4″5/8″

A 5 mm bit and a 3/16″ bit are close but not identical — 5 mm is 0.197″ and 3/16″ is 0.188″. A 5 mm pin in a 3/16″ hole will not go; a 3/16″ pin in a 5 mm hole is slightly loose but works. Pick one and stay with it.

Always use a depth stop. Drilling through the side of a cabinet is the classic shelf-pin mistake, and on a 3/4″ side with a 1/2″ hole you have only 1/4″ of margin.

Setback from the edges

The 32 mm system puts the front column 37 mm (about 1-7/16″) back from the front edge. For shop work, 2″ from front and back is a common and forgiving choice. What matters structurally is that the pins sit far enough in to be clear of the edge banding and far enough from the back to support the shelf against tipping.

Getting all four columns to line up

The whole job is registration. Every column must start at the same height from the same reference, or the shelf rocks.

  1. Mark a single reference edge on every panel — conventionally the bottom — and label it before you start.
  2. Always register the jig from that same edge, never from the top on one panel and the bottom on another.
  3. Drill both side panels of a cabinet as a pair, in the same session, with the same setup.
  4. Where a jig is shorter than the run, use the last hole drilled as the index pin for the next position rather than re-measuring.

An error of even 1 mm between the front and back columns produces a visibly tilted shelf.
